I have been using a vader's vault 1" blade for my ASP saber, and recently the tip flew off when dueling. After doing some research, I learned that dichloromethane (aka methylene chloride) is used to bond polycarbonate sheets, and that the blades are polycarbonate blades.

Now here's the cool bit: I am in Organic Chemistry 2. It broke on Friday, and Sunday evening I was reading the lab instruction for today, Monday. Not only is there an hour of free time while a condenser is running, but part of the materials in use is dichloromethane. Emailed my professor and he's like "Bring it in."

The blade is totally repaired, all that's left is to sand the finish (what grit does VV use when they sand their blades?).

Nice! Yeah, they use Weld-On3 in the first place. Superglue and/or E6000 work in a pinch too.

As for sanding... first they dig in with 60 grit to rough it up, then I believe they go up to about 400 grit. I actually take 800 grit to mine when I get them just to smooth them out a bit more.
